A Maryland court may declare an absolute divorce based on desertion. There are three requirements: One spouse deserted the other spouse for a continuous period of at least 12 months; The desertion is deliberate and final; and. WebNov 4, 2024 · A divorce court judge's decision can be appealed to a state court of appeals. While deference is given to the original judge's opinion in a divorce case, it is unusual but not impossible for an appeals court to overturn the lower court judge's decision. In Maryland, there are two types of divorce: absolute divorce and limited divorce. An absolute divorce is a permanent end of the marriage. If a court grants an absolute divorce, the final order of the divorce is set forth in a “divorce decree” or “decree.”.
